Abstract

Digital Flipbook Ecosystem (DFE) based on Problem Based Learning (PBL) was developed as an innovative learning media to facilitate the understanding of ecosystem material interactively and contextually. This study aims to develop DFE and analyze its feasibility and influence on students' critical thinking skills. The research method uses the Hannafin and Peck development model consisting of needs analysis, design, and development and implementation, followed by evaluation and revision at each stage. The results of expert validation show that DFE is very valid and suitable for use as a biology learning medium. The implementation of DFE has been shown to improve students' critical thinking skills in the indicators of organizing strategies and tactics, making further explanations, concluding, building basic skills, and providing simple explanations. These findings prove that PBL-based DFE is effective in improving students' critical thinking skills in biology learning.
